A 6.1-magnitude earthquake struck off the coast of Japan — Iwate Prefecture in northeastern Japan early Sunday, following a series of recent tremors in the region. The Japan — Japan Meteorological Agency reported the quake occurred at a depth of 41 kilometers and registered a maximum seismic intensity of lower 5 in Hachinohe City, Japan — Aomori Prefecture, and Fudai Village, Japan — Iwate Prefecture. Tremors were felt across a wide area from Japan — Hokkaido to the Japan — Kantō region. Japanese Prime Minister Sanae Takaichi confirmed there was no tsunami risk and instructed officials to assess damage and provide timely information. Authorities warned of increased risks of rockfalls and landslides in areas affected by strong shaking, urging residents to remain vigilant for further seismic activity. This event occurred in the same offshore Iwate area as a stronger earthquake on June 25.
